“One of our favorite things is to find a " mom & pop" restaurant that cares about the entire experience and then nails the execution. At Cookbook, you are greeted by the owners, who seat you, answer your questions about their restaurant/menu, then take your order, etc. Tonight, this was followed by a great cup of sausage and kale soup, bison ragu with brocholini for me, squash bolognese for my wife, then the seven layer cake which we shared. All of these (except the cake) were piping hot and made with fresh produce and proteins. As for the cake, it was wonderful and the perfect way to end a perfect dining experience. The family atmosphere reminded me of meals I've had in small family run places in Ferringdon(outside London), Milan, Grenoble, Angier, Seville, Toledo, Madrid, and Augsburg, etc... Felt old school European, including the pride of ownership and the simple ingredients prepared well. If you find yourself in Sun Valley area, give this place a go, but might want to make a reservation as Cookbook is pretty small and filled up quickly tonight.Vegetarian options: Couple of options.“
